Dutch state-owned Staatsloterij is the oldest running lottery

The Dutch state-owned Staatsloterij has been running for over 230 years and is known for its reliability and high prize payouts. Many organizations in the Netherlands have used the funds from this lottery to help support their work. This lottery pays out prizes for 4.3 million people every month.

The Dutch Staatsloterij is the world’s oldest continuously-running lottery. The first draw took place in Sluis in 1434. It quickly became popular and helped raise funds for freeing slaves and helping the poor in the Netherlands. Today, the Staatsloterij is one of the most popular forms of entertainment and taxation in the Netherlands.

Lotteries have a long and rich history in the United States. They were a popular way to fund public-works projects during the early days of the American Revolution. In 1612, the Virginia Company sponsored the first lottery, which raised 29,000 pounds for the colony’s development. In the eighteenth century, colonial lotteries were used to build churches and wharves. In 1768, George Washington sponsored a lottery to help build a road through the Blue Ridge Mountains.

They are anonymous

The lottery has many benefits, and stories about ordinary people winning big are immensely popular. Not only do these stories inspire people to play the lottery, they also boost ticket sales. However, there are also risks involved, including insiders who can rig the system. One recent example of this was the 2017 Hot Lotto scandal. In this case, the information security director at the Multi-State Lottery Association rigged the lottery’s random number generator. This resulted in the robbery of millions of dollars worth of prize winnings. A lottery winner who was anonymous could have helped prevent this from happening.

While keeping lottery winners anonymous might seem a bit odd, it can be good for the lottery system in general. It also makes it easier to uncover scams. For example, a computer programmer working for the Multi-State Lottery Association hacked a lottery program and was able to predict lottery numbers. His efforts paid off, and he won several million dollars. In the end, he was caught when he bought a winning ticket in his own name. In the end, revealing his identity made it easy to catch him and prevent him from stealing millions of dollars from lottery winners.
